Adult circumcision is typically performed as an outpatient procedure under local or general anesthesia. Unlike the quick process used for infants, adult surgery requires precise incisions and sutures to ensure proper healing and aesthetic results. The surgeon carefully measures the amount of skin to be removed, makes the necessary incisions, and uses dissolvable stitches to close the wound.
